C. J. Miller Ordained
Cecil John Miller was ordained as an evangelist by the Presbytery of California at an adjourned meeting in Stockton on October 9. The Presbytery itself, at its regular meeting on September 24, had issued a call to Mr. Miller to undertake the work of an evangelist following his satisfactory completion of the examinations for ordination. As a licentiate of the Presbytery, Mr. Miller has been serving as stated supply of Bethany Church, of Stockton, and he will continue to minister in that capacity.
Moderator of the meeting was the Rev. R. J. Rushdoony, of Santa Cruz. Following the reading of Scripture by the Rev. Salvador Solis, of San Francisco, the Rev. Arthur Riffel, Brentwood, led in prayer. "What mean ye by these stones?" (Joshua 4:6) was the theme of the sermon preached by the Rev. Henry Coray, Presbytery's home missionary in Sunnyvale.
After the ordination by the laying on of hands by the presbyters, the Rev. Richard Lewis, of Berkeley, gave a solemn charge to Mr. Miller, and the newly ordained man dismissed the congregation with the benediction. Members of the congregation and other friends who were present were served refreshments by the ladies and the young people of Bethany Church, in the fellowship hour which followed. The congregation presented a Bible to Mr. Miller. "It is our prayer that his service may be long and fruitful," wrote Elder Clarence Westra in behalf of the session and congregation, "and that he may indeed be zealous for the honor of his Lord and Master, and may be instrumental in bringing many souls to a saving knowledge of our Savior Jesus Christ."
